March 3, 2023 (United States)
83 min | Drama, Mystery, Sci-Fi
A psychedelic journey across Los Angeles to find his stolen motorbike leads antihero Todd Tarantula through a time-bending experience where he must uncover the secrets of his past.
Director: Ansel Faraj | Stars: David Selby, Nathan Wilson, Kelly Erin Decker, Douglas M. Eames